Opening Weekend for Commuters at The College of New Rochelle is an exciting affair for all of you. For new commuter students, the adventure begins with Fall Orientation where you will become acclimated with CNR student life and leadership opportunities. Upon check-in on the Friday before Labor Day, you will receive your college ID and Fall Orientation schedule.
Returning commuters, you will need to get your current ID validated in the Office of Safety & Security during their normal business hours. Please note that all College offices are closed on Labor Day.
As a commuter, you are invited to participate in the Weeks of Welcome events that are held throughout the month of September.
